THE POLE-FINDER.
AMUNDSEN POSTPONES HIS NORTHERN ATTACK. [UNITED PRESS ASSOCIATION —COPYRIGHT] (Received Sent, 29. 5.5 p.m-) CHRISTIANA, Sept, 29. After conferring" with Nansen and the Government. Amundsen has postponed the expedition of the Fram to the North Pole for a year. His oceanographer is unable to join the expedition at present, and it is impossible to replace him.
